Obituary for Verna Ryals (Darden)

“To everything there is a season, and a time to every purpose under the heaven".

Ms. Verna Darden-Ryals was born to Ms. Ramona Boswell and Joe L. “Sarge” Darden on June 12, 1963, in Tacoma, Washington. She attended public school in Wayne County and graduated from Wayne County High School. Verna received her Cosmetology License at Altamaha Technical College in Jesup, Georgia, Culinary Arts Diploma from Irwin County Technical College, Home Health Certificate from Columbia, South Carolina, and Foster Parenting Certificate from Columbia, South Carolina. Verna recently became a Wayne Memorial Hospital Volunteer.

Verna was a loving mother and caretaker. Her love for children led her to become a Foster Parent and Direct Support Specialist for those with Special Needs and Disabilities. Verna was a certified culinary specialist who loved cooking. She would feed or clothe anyone in need. She loved spending time with her family, traveling, shopping and cooking. She had a very unique style and didn’t mind dressing up.

On Saturday morning, October 02, 2021, Verna loosed her earthly grip, and took a hold to God’s hand. She was predeceased by her parents, Ramona Boswell, and Joe L. “Sarge” Darden (Rosa) and brother, Larry Bonham.
